Troubleshooting Common Login Issues
Sometimes, even with the best instructions, things can go wrong. Here's a rundown of common login problems and how to fix them. Knowing these troubleshooting steps can save you a lot of frustration and get you back on track quickly.
- Incorrect Username or Password: This is the most common reason for login failures. Double-check that you've entered your username and password correctly. Remember that passwords are case-sensitive. If you're still having trouble, try the "Forgot Password" option (explained below).
- Forgot Password: Most online platforms offer a "Forgot Password" or "Password Reset" link on the login page. Click this link and follow the instructions to reset your password. You'll usually be asked to provide your email address or username, and a password reset link will be sent to your email. Make sure to check your spam or junk folder if you don't see the email in your inbox. Follow the instructions in the email to create a new, secure password.
- Account Locked Out: Some systems will lock your account after multiple failed login attempts. This is a security measure to prevent unauthorized access. If your account is locked, you'll usually see a message indicating that you need to wait a certain amount of time before trying again. Alternatively, you may need to contact your IT support or the platform administrator to unlock your account.
- Browser Issues: Sometimes, browser-related issues can prevent you from logging in. Try clearing your browser's cache and cookies. This can often resolve conflicts with website data. You can also try using a different web browser to see if the issue is specific to your current browser. Make sure your browser is up to date, as outdated browsers can sometimes cause compatibility problems.
- Internet Connection Problems: A stable internet connection is essential for logging into online platforms. Check your internet connection to make sure you're connected to the internet. If you're using Wi-Fi, make sure you're connected to the correct network and that the signal strength is strong. Try restarting your modem and router to refresh your internet connection.
- System Maintenance: Occasionally, the OSC 3 Plus system may be undergoing maintenance, which can temporarily prevent you from logging in. Check for any announcements or notifications from the platform administrator regarding scheduled maintenance. If maintenance is underway, simply wait until it's completed before trying to log in again.
- Two-Factor Authentication Issues: If you have two-factor authentication (2FA) enabled, you'll need to enter a code from your authenticator app or receive a code via SMS to complete the login process. Make sure you have access to your authenticator app or phone and that you're entering the correct code. If you're having trouble with 2FA, contact your IT support for assistance.

Staying Secure Online
While we're talking about logging in, let's quickly touch on online security. Keeping your account secure is super important to protect your personal information and prevent unauthorized access. Here are a few tips to keep in mind:
- Use a Strong Password: Your password should be at least 12 characters long and include a combination of uppercase and lowercase letters, numbers, and symbols. Avoid using easily guessable information, such as your name, birthday, or common words. The stronger your password, the harder it will be for someone to crack it.
- Don't Share Your Password: Never share your password with anyone, even if they claim to be from IT support. Legitimate IT support personnel will never ask you for your password. Sharing your password can compromise your account security and put your personal information at risk.
- Enable Two-Factor Authentication (2FA): If OSC 3 Plus offers two-factor authentication, enable it. 2FA adds an extra layer of security to your account by requiring you to enter a code from your authenticator app or receive a code via SMS in addition to your password. This makes it much more difficult for someone to access your account, even if they know your password.
- Keep Your Software Updated: Keep your web browser, operating system, and other software up to date with the latest security patches. These updates often include fixes for security vulnerabilities that could be exploited by hackers.
- Be Careful of Phishing Scams: Be wary of suspicious emails or messages that ask you to click on links or provide your login credentials. Phishing scams are designed to trick you into revealing sensitive information. Always verify the sender's identity before clicking on any links or providing any information. If you're unsure whether an email is legitimate, contact the sender directly to verify.
- Log Out When You're Finished: When you're finished using OSC 3 Plus, always log out of your account. This prevents unauthorized access to your account if someone else uses your computer or device.
